Bio
Taylor Nielsen is a registered nurse and board-certified women’s health nurse practitioner. She has been caring for the women of North Texas since 2015 and began her career as a Labor and Delivery nurse at Texas Health HEB. Her areas of focus include gynecologic and pelvic care, preconception health and family planning, and normal and high-risk pregnancy.
Taylor earned her bachelor’s degree in nursing from Stephen F. Austin State University in Nacogdoches, Texas. She went on to earn her master’s degree in women’s health nurse practitioner studies. Tayler is a member of the Nurse Practitioners in Women’s Health organization and Texas Nurse Practitioners. She strives to empower women to take charge of their health and prioritizes creating lasting relationships with her patients to encourage health maintenance.
